引言
ASP.NET MVC(Model-View-Controller)框架是微软针对Web应用程序开发推出的一种设计模式,它通过分离应用程序的逻辑组件(模型、视图和控制器),为开发人员提供了更灵活、可维护和可测试的方式来构建Web应用程序。本篇博客将快速介绍ASP.NET MVC框架的基本概念和使用方法,帮助你快速入门并开始构建灵活的Web应用程序。
第一步:创建新的ASP.NET MVC项目
首先,我们需要在Visual Studio中创建一个新的ASP.NET MVC项目。打开Visual Studio,点击“新建项目”,在模板中选择“ASP.NET Web应用程序(.NET Framework)”,并输入项目名称。在下拉菜单中选择“MVC”,然后点击“确定”按钮。
第二步:理解MVC的基本概念
ASP.NET MVC框架基于MVC设计模式,主要由以下三个组件组成:
-
模型(Model):模型负责处理业务逻辑和数据访问,与数据源进行交互并提供相关操作。你可以在模型中定义数据模型、验证规则以及与数据库的交互操作。
-
视图(View):视图负责呈现数据给用户,并处理与用户的交互。你可以在视图中使用HTML、CSS和JavaScript来创建用户界面和交互功能。
-
控制器(Controller):控制器负责处理用户请求和调度模型数据的加载和视图的显示。控制器与用户交互,并根据用户的请求调用相应的模型和视图组件。
第三步:创建控制器和视图
在ASP.NET MVC中,控制器和视图是互相配合的。控制器负责接收用户的请求,处理逻辑,并调用相应的视图进行呈现。接下来,我们将创建一个最简单的控制器和视图来演示这个过程。
-
在Visual Studio中,打开“解决方案资源管理器”,右键点击“Controllers”文件夹,选择“添加”->“控制器”。输入控制器名称,比如“HomeController”,然后点击“添加”按钮。
-
在控制器文件中,添加一个简单的动作方法。比如,我们可以添加一个名为“Index”的方法,用于处理默认的页面请求。在方法中,我们可以调用相应的视图进行呈现。示例代码如下:
public class HomeController : Controller
{
public ActionResult Index()
{
return View();
}
}
-
接下来,我们需要创建一个对应的视图。右键点击“Views”文件夹,选择“添加”->“视图”。输入视图名称,比如“Index”,然后点击“添加”按钮。
-
在视图文件中,使用HTML、CSS和JavaScript等代码来构建页面布局和内容。可以根据需要进行自定义,呈现所需的数据和交互功能。
第四步:运行应用程序并查看结果
现在,我们已经创建了一个最简单的ASP.NET MVC应用程序。接下来,我们将运行应用程序并查看结果。
-
在Visual Studio中,点击“调试”->“启动调试”(或按下F5键)来运行应用程序。
-
应用程序将在Web浏览器中打开,并显示我们刚刚创建的默认页面。
-
你可以尝试修改控制器或视图中的代码,并重新运行应用程序来查看相应的更改和效果。
结论
通过本篇博客,我们快速了解了ASP.NET MVC框架的基本概念和使用方法。ASP.NET MVC框架提供了一种灵活、可维护和可测试的方式来构建Web应用程序。你可以根据项目的需求,按照MVC设计模式来组织代码,并分离关注点,提高开发效率和代码质量。希望本篇博客能够帮助你快速入门ASP.NET MVC框架,并开始构建灵活的Web应用程序。
如果你对ASP.NET MVC框架感兴趣,更多关于ASP.NET MVC框架的进阶教程和实践经验,请关注我的博客。
最后,如果你有任何问题或意见,欢迎在下方评论区分享。谢谢阅读!
参考链接:
本文来自极简博客,作者:灵魂导师,转载请注明原文链接:快速入门ASP.NET MVC框架:构建灵活的Web应用程序